USACO 2020 US Open — the season finals, all four divisions.

The US Open is the last round of the 2019–20 USACO season and runs a full 5 hours per division, twice as much breathing room as the Dec/Jan/Feb 4-hour rounds. The contest at a glance

Bronze

Bronze · 3 problems

1. Social Distancing I — place K cows in disjoint stall intervals to maximize the minimum pairwise distance (binary search on D).

2. Social Distancing II — given positions and infection states on a line, find the smallest infection radius R consistent with the data.

3. Cowntact Tracing — simulate timed pairwise handshakes and bound the count of possible patient zeros and infection chains (brute force over candidates).

Silver

Silver · 3 problems

1. Social Distancing — Silver version: K cows into M disjoint intervals on the line maximizing min distance (binary search + greedy placement).

2. Cereal — each cow has a 1st and 2nd cereal choice; for each k count cows served when only cows k..N−1 line up (Union-Find / chain compression).

3. The Moo Particle — particles with (x, y) spins; pairs annihilate iff xi ≤ xj ∧ yi ≤ yj. Minimum remaining = sort + count y-descents.

Gold

Gold · 3 problems

1. Haircut — for every length j compute the number of inversions in the array after capping every value at j (Fenwick on values).

2. Favorite Colors — repeatedly merge nodes that share an in-neighbor until stable; output the canonical color labels (Union-Find + worklist).

3. Exercise — sum over all permutations of N of the LCM of cycle lengths, modulo M (DP over partitions of N by prime powers).

Platinum

Platinum · 3 problems

1. Sprinklers 2: Return of the Alfalfa — count ways to split an N×N grid into a "left/down sprinkler" region and a "right/up sprinkler" region around an alfalfa rectangle (row-DP with prefix sums).

2. Exercise — Platinum: same LCM-sum but over N ≤ 104, modulo M (prime-power knapsack DP).

3. Circus — count distinct rooted "stretchings" of a tree where K cows ride on K vertices and inner cows can slide along edges (tree DP).

How to use this set

  1. Pick your division. Open the full division page and read all three statements before writing any code — 5 hours rewards a calm reading sweep first.
  2. Order the attack. US Open P1 is usually the cheapest problem; P3 is almost always the hardest. Solve in order unless P2 obviously matches a pattern you already know.
  3. Time-box. 5 hours total. Don't sink more than ~2 hours into a single problem without at least the easiest subtask submission banked.
